88 Points | International Wine Cellar , November/December 2010

($22) Pale yellow-gold. Pungent aromas of soft citrus fruits, lemon and spices, with complicating notes of earth and minerals. Rich, buttery and moderately sweet, with some unabsorbed CO2 and firm acidity giving verve to this fairly large-scaled, very ripe pinot blanc. Turns drier and more minerally on the tactile, chewy finish, which hints at spicy oak and hazelnut. Offers plenty of dimension for the variety.

About Alsace

Alsace has been almost pathologically ignored by the American wine-drinking public for generations--a real mystery in light of the great number of juicy, pure wines produced in this picture-postcard region of northeastern France.
